Jamie Foxx Joins Director Noam Murro’s Blink

Jamie Foxx will star in Blink.Atlas Entertainment has announced that Academy Award-winning actor Jamie Foxx (Django Unchained, Horrible Bosses) has joined Noam Murro’s Blink. The Black List script was written by Hernany Perla. Production is slated to begin this fall, with Atlas Entertainment’s William Green and Aaron Ginsburg producing and Atlas’ Jake Kurily serving as an executive producer. Highland Film Group (HFG) is handling international sales of the film to international territories at the Cannes Film Festival.

In the film, Foxx plays a hospital caregiver tasked with caring for a mysterious victim of a bank robbery and as the two become closer, we discover that the caregiver has ulterior motives of his own.

Murro recently directed Warner Bros.’ Pictures 300: Rise of an Empire starring Sullivan Stapleton, Eva Green and Lena Headey, which opened #1 at the box office and went on to gross over $337 million worldwide.
